Spiritual Journey

Prayer with the Reward of Umrah

Masjid Quba is located on the outskirts of Madinah. It holds immense spiritual significance, as the Prophet (PBUH) said that whoever purifies themselves at home and comes to Masjid Quba to pray two Raka'at will have the reward of an Umrah.

While there is a new walking path from the Haram, it is over 3km long and can be exhausting in the heat, especially for the elderly. A taxi is the most comfortable way to visit.

Best Times to Visit

  • 1

    Saturday Mornings

    Following the Sunnah of the Prophet (PBUH) who used to visit every Saturday.

  • 2

    Early Morning (Duha)

    To avoid the crowds and midday heat. The mosque is open 24/7 (usually).

  • 3

    Between Maghrib & Isha

    A peaceful time to reflect and recite Quran.

How far is Masjid Quba from Masjid Nabawi?

Quick Answer:10-15 mins
It is about 3.5 km away, which takes 10-15 minutes by car depending on traffic lights.
